Transaction 69687cc42082660ed5143d4539c60f918d492c42b69e5ee9a8d8151a16846444
1 Input
1 Output
-
69687cc42082660ed5143d4539c60f918d492c42b69e5ee9a8d8151a16846444:0
- value
- 1594300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 551b0fb66918d414401388dfcad719bee5ff98c6 OP_EQUAL
- address
- 39T1n79UbDD11zphKrw8zhiZhH9CSYwg2n